Easy Tteokbokki

Prep time: 5 minutes Cook time: 10 minutes Serves 1 person

*Side note: Tteokbokki is a Korean spicy rice cake. It is usually serve as a side dish, snack or street food. This Tteokbokki recipe is the simplest and easiest ever with just 5 ingredients.

Ingredients:

-1 cup rice cake (dduk/tteok)

-2 tsp Korean spicy bean paste (gochujang)

-2 tsp sugar

-1 tsp soy sauce

-3/4 cup water


Instructions:

1. 1 cup of rice cakes is about 5-6 oz. Defrost frozen rice cakes.


2. Add water, gochujang, and sugar to pan and bring to a boil on a medium-high heat.


3. Add the tteokbokki tteok to the gochujang water and lower the heat to a simmer. Simmer for 8-10 minutes.


Serve hot and Enjoy!!


**Recipe note: When doing tteokbokki, fresh rice cakes are always preferable since the frozen ones end up dry and cracked but either one is fine (do what's better for your budget/availability). You can add boiled eggs, fish cakes, veggies, firm tofu or meats at your preference for added texture, making the dish heartier.
